Depression and Religion: Realities,Perspectives, and Directions
Authors:EVA H CADWALLADER
Abstract:The debate between psychologists hostile and friendly to religion regarding whether religion promotes or deters depression is reviewed from a historical perspective. Two modes of religion can be seen as forming a continuum with one pole as a life-celebrating, self-affirming religion that deters depression and the other pole as a life-constricting, self-derogating religion that promotes depression. Counselors are advised to help lead religious clients out of depression by procedures aimed at moving them from unhealthy toward healthy religious modes
